Output b26f574d5e31efb73a987cfb2d8b305ec17c3cbff0e24e4d60ad3ee9472eb74d:0

value
310155278
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 85a31ffa0e96d4ad4c8b7dfb0a1eb608bbdf2ac53a76d5a770d607220fc9ffdd
address
tb1psk33l7swjm226nyt0has584kpzaa72k98fmdtfms6crjyr7fllwsrguq9n
transaction
b26f574d5e31efb73a987cfb2d8b305ec17c3cbff0e24e4d60ad3ee9472eb74d